随着互联网技术的不断发展,前后端分离的架构模式已经成为了Web开发的主流。在这个架构模式下,JSP(JavaServer Pages)作为后端技术之一,经常需要将数据或请求传递给HTML页面。本文将详细讲解JSP如何传请求给HTML实例,并提供一些实用的实例和技巧,帮助开发者更好地实现前后端交互。

一、JSP与HTML的关系

我们需要明确JSP和HTML之间的关系。JSP是一种动态网页技术,它允许在HTML页面中嵌入Java代码。当服务器接收到JSP页面请求时,会首先解析其中的HTML内容,然后将Java代码编译成Java类,最后执行该类并返回结果。

jsp传请求给html实例_jsp怎么传参  第1张

HTML则是静态网页技术,它主要由标签组成,用于描述网页的结构、内容和样式。HTML页面本身无法执行任何操作,需要通过JSP等技术来实现动态交互。

二、JSP传请求给HTML实例的原理

JSP传请求给HTML实例主要依赖于以下几种技术:

1. 超链接(Hyperlink):通过设置超链接的`href`属性为JSP页面的URL,用户点击后即可将请求传递给JSP页面。

2. 表单(Form):在HTML页面中添加表单,用户填写表单信息并提交后,请求将被传递给JSP页面。

3. JavaScript:利用JavaScript在客户端编写代码,发送请求给JSP页面。

4. Ajax:结合JavaScript和XMLHttpRequest对象,实现无需刷新页面的异步请求。

下面,我们将分别介绍这几种技术的实现方法。

三、超链接传请求给HTML实例

实例

假设我们有一个HTML页面`index.html`,其中包含一个超链接``,指向JSP页面`show.jsp`。

```html

首页

本文由 @望喜 发布在 读恩技术网,如有疑问,请联系我们。
文章链接:http://www.denzx.cn/article/nphIOH_qenLzlruSxITiK